logo

Output efe61053f7a73ce44b8a3f99ba815fcafe39373ed6b3f58cee880d286c7eeb47:1

value
15556843
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45b884bc0e9f41885b068630cca22f031ae39dd9 OP_EQUALVERIFY OP_CHECKSIG
address
17Mefokacx37E4jDyTKeAfCzrrYccVBX1y
transaction
efe61053f7a73ce44b8a3f99ba815fcafe39373ed6b3f58cee880d286c7eeb47